Hale Family Papers. From
1787-1978. 143 boxes, 51 volumes (61 linear ft.)
These papers are in the possession of Smith College.
Papers consist of biographical
material, artwork, artifacts,
correspondence, speeches, photographs, writings, and memorabilia
created or kept by Hale Family members and their Everett, Beecher,
Gilman, Hooker, Perkins, Stowe, and Westcott relatives. Primary
documents the households of Nathan, Sr., and Sarah Preston (Everett)
Hale; Edward Everett and Emily (Perkins) Hale; Ellen Day Hale; and
Philip and Lilian (Westcott) Hale.
